How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Blue Heron Breeze?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Blue Heron Breeze Studio Apartments | $1,220 | $1,215 | $1,225 |
| Blue Heron Breeze 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,544 | $1,200 | $2,095 |
| Blue Heron Breeze 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,809 | $1,325 | $2,595 |
| Blue Heron Breeze 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,111 | $1,705 | $2,695 |
| Blue Heron Breeze 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,495 | $2,495 | $2,495 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Blue Heron Breeze
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Blue Heron Breeze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Blue Heron Breeze ranges from $1,200 to $2,095 with an average monthly rent of $1,544.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Blue Heron Breeze c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Blue Heron Breeze range from $1,325 to $2,595.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,809.
How expensive are Blue Heron Breeze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 24 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Blue Heron Breeze on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,705 to $2,695 - averaging $2,111 for the location.
